Property Overview: 27 Apex Street, Winnipeg
Key Characteristics & Appeal
This is a spacious, well-established two-storey home in Elmhurst, built in 1986. Its primary appeal lies in its generous proportions and mature lot. With over 2,400 sqft of living space, it ranks in the top 2-3% of homes locally for size, offering ample room for a growing or multi-generational family. The property sits on a large 6,239 sqft lot and features a finished basement and an attached garage.
The home’s value is underscored by its strong market position: it surpasses approximately 94% of all Winnipeg homes in assessed value. While 40 years old, its construction date is newer than 70% of area homes, suggesting it may have more modern infrastructure than many in its peer group. The appeal here is solidity and space over brand-new condition. It would suit buyers looking for established neighbourhood character, who prioritize square footage and a sizable yard over a brand-new build, and who see potential in a property that already has strong foundational value.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What does the "ranking" data actually mean?
The rankings compare this home against others on its street, in Elmhurst, and across all of Winnipeg for specific metrics. For example, ranking in the top 3% for living size means only 3% of Winnipeg homes are larger. It's a quick way to gauge how it stands out or fits in.
2. Is a 40-year-old home a concern?
While systems will require due diligence, the data shows this home is newer than 70% of Winnipeg houses. This suggests it may have updates or components that are relatively younger than the broader market, but a thorough inspection is essential.
3. The lot is large, but what's the condition and potential?
A 6,239 sqft lot offers excellent outdoor space. Prospective buyers should consider the current landscape's upkeep, the potential for gardening, expansions, or outdoor living areas, and any mature trees that add privacy or require maintenance.
4. How should I interpret the high assessment value relative to the price?
An assessment that ranks in the top 6% city-wide indicates the municipality views it as a high-value property. This can be a positive sign of its base worth and potential equity, but the final market price is determined by current buyer demand and condition.
5. What's the neighbourhood feel of Elmhurst?
As an established area with homes spanning many decades, Elmhurst typically offers tree-lined streets and a settled community atmosphere. The high ranking for lot size on this street suggests a particularly spacious and possibly less dense feel compared to newer subdivisions.
